Course Name : Electronics and Tele Communication Engineering
Qualification : 10+ with science subject
Qualification : 10+ with science subject
Course Duration : 3 years
Course Structure : Semester System
Industrial Training : A minimum duration of two weeks of industrial training included each semester break except after Ist semester (i.e. there will be industrial training during summer vacation after 2nd, 3rd, 4th and 5th semesters. Internal assessment out of 50 marks will be added in 3rd, 4th, 5th and 6th semesters respectively. Total marks allotted to industrial training will be 200.
Functions
- Skills in reading and interpreting drawings pertaining to electronic circuits, instruments, and equipment
- Understanding of basic principles of electrical and electronics engineering
- Understanding of electrical machines and equipment
- Understanding of basic principles of digital electronics; communication engineering and systems; audio video systems and industrial electronics
- Knowledge of different electronic devices, components, materials and instruments used in manufacturing and testing of electronic products
- Skills in fabrication and testing of different types of electronic circuits and devices by making use of testing and measuring instruments
- Skills in fabrication of PCBs and designing the layout of various instruments, chassis and equipment for wiring/circuit development

Further Education
Students can opt for AMIE, Grade IETE, can get admission in IInd year Bachelor of Engineering based on merit of Diploma or through entrance exam for further education.
Employment Opportunities
The feedback from industries and other organizations has revealed that diploma holders in Electronics and Tele-Communication Engineering find employment in the following organizations:
Various Departments/ organizations/boards and corporations
Tele-Communication Engineering and related Departments , AIR, Doordarshan, Overseas Communication, Mine Communication, Radar and Wireless, Railways, Defence Services, Para-military Forces, Civil Aviation, Defence Research and Development Organisations, Electricity Boards and Corporations etc.
Industry
Communication Industry manufacturing wireless mobile equipment for defence and Paramilitary forces, PCB Design and Fabrication Industry, Consumer Electronics Industry, Electronic Components and Devices Manufacturing and Installation Organizations, Computer Assembling and Computer Peripheral Industry, Computer Software Areas for Electronic Design and Semi Conductor Manufacturing Industry, Instrumentation and Control Industries
Development/Testing Laboratories/Organizations
Electronics Service Centres, Opto Electronics, Computer Networking, Hospitals, Educational Institutions( ITIs, Vocational Schools etc), Sales and Services of Electronic Gadgets from Small Scale Industries, Call Centres
Self Employment
Marketing and Sales (Distributors - whole sale and retailers), Service Sector( repair and Maintenance; job work), Cable laying and jointing DBs etc., Preparing Simulated Models
